Air Source Heat Pumps vs. Geothermal Warmth Pumps



When considering Air Source Warm Pumps vs. Geothermal Warm Pumps for your home, there are key differences to keep in mind.

Air Source Warmth Pumps extract warm from the outdoors air and are extra usual as a result of reduced installation costs. They work well in moderate climates however may be much less effective in severe cold.

Geothermal Heat Pumps, on the other hand, utilize heat from the ground, giving consistent heating and cooling down regardless of exterior temperatures. While they've higher ahead of time expenses, they're a lot more energy-efficient over time and have a longer life-span.

Air Source Warmth Pumps are simpler to mount and preserve contrasted to Geothermal Heat Pumps, which call for more intricate underground setups. Nevertheless, Geothermal Heat Pumps offer better energy financial savings over time, making them an extra eco-friendly option.



Consider your climate, budget plan, and long-lasting objectives when selecting between these two kinds of heatpump for your home.

Cost Evaluation: Installment and Procedure Costs



Considering the expenses related to both setup and procedure is essential when contrasting Air Source Heat Pumps and Geothermal Heat Pumps. Air Source Warmth Pumps are typically more budget friendly to mount ahead of time contrasted to Geothermal Warm Pumps. The setup of a Geothermal Heat Pump includes more complicated below ground job, making it a costlier choice at first. Nonetheless, Geothermal Heat Pumps are recognized for their higher effectiveness, which can result in reduced operational prices over time.

When it involves functional expenditures, Geothermal Warm Pumps tend to be extra affordable in the future as a result of their greater effectiveness and reduced power consumption. They can offer substantial financial savings on heating and cooling costs, offsetting the higher setup expenses.

Air Resource Warmth Pumps, while having reduced in advance expenses, may lead to slightly higher functional costs because they aren't as effective as their geothermal counterparts.
